Experiencing Changes in Temperature


Your water heater has a thermostat, as well as the water created must remain around that very same temperature you set for the unit. If your water comes to be as well warm or as well chilly all of an abrupt, it can suggest that your water heating unit thermostat is no much longer doing its task. Initially, examination points out by utilizing a marker and tape. After that examine to see later if the noting go on its very own. It implies your heating unit is unstable if it does.

Producing Insufficient Hot Water


If there is insufficient hot water for you and also your family, yet you have not transformed your usage practices, then that's the sign that your water heater is failing. Usually, growing families and also an additional bathroom show that you need to scale approximately a bigger system to meet your needs.
Nevertheless, when every little thing coincides, yet your hot water heater instantly doesn't meet your hot water needs, consider a specialist evaluation because your device is not performing to requirement.

Seeing Puddles as well as leaks


When you see a water leakage, check to pipelines, connectors, as well as screws. You may just need to tighten up some of them. If you see puddles collected at the base of the heating device, you must call for an immediate assessment because it shows you have actually got an energetic leak that can be a problem with your storage tank itself or the pipes.

Hearing Odd Seems


When uncommon sounds like knocking and tapping on your equipment, this indicates sediment build-up. It belongs to sedimentary rocks, which are tough and make a great deal of noise when banging versus metal. If left neglected, these pieces can produce tears on the metal, triggering leaks.
You can still conserve your water heating system by draining it and cleaning it. Simply be cautious due to the fact that dealing with this is dangerous, whether it is a gas or electric system.

Observing Odiferous or over Cast Water


Does your water suddenly stink like rotten eggs and look dirty? Your water heating unit might be acting up if you smell something odd. Your water must be tidy as well as fresh scenting as in the past. Otherwise, you can have corrosion build-up as well as microorganisms contamination. It suggests the integrated anode pole in your maker is no more doing its task, so you need it replaced stat.

Aging Beyond Requirement Life Expectancy


If your hot water heater is greater than 10 years old, you should think about changing it. That's the natural lifespan of this machine! With proper upkeep, you can expand it for a couple of even more years. On the other hand, without a regular tune-up, the life expectancy can be shorter. You may consider water heater substitute if you recognize your hot water heater is old, combined with the other issues discussed over.

Recognizing the Signs of a Damaged Water Heater


Winter may be mostly behind us but having hot water in our homes is a necessity year-round. A broken water heater can be a time-consuming and costly problem.



Recognizing the signs of a water heater in distress, and knowing what to do about it, is the best way to avoid a full-blown water heater "meltdown."



Sediment buildup, rust, and high water pressure are some of the most common causes of water heater failure. Improper installation or equipment sizing are other commonly found issues. A leak can occur near the supply line which can cause damage to dry wall or flooring.



Like any appliance, frequent checks can prevent your water heater from becoming a big problem. Try to set an annual reminder to check for water pooling around your water heater and to tighten any loose fittings you might find. The quicker the issue is resolved, the less damage it will cause in the end.



If you do find signs that your water heater is broken or about to burst, the first thing to do is to shut it off. For gas water heaters, twist the dial at the top of the thermostat from ON to OFF. If it’s an electric heater, switch the circuit breaker to OFF.


Once the water heater is turned off follow these steps:


  • Turn off the water supply.


  • Completely drain the water heater.


  • Open the pressure relief valve.


  • Rinse the water heater with cold water when the unit has finished draining.
